The most important question a person can ask himself is, "Have I been born again?" In John Chapter 3, Jesus told Nicodemus that he must be born again in order to see the Kingdom of God. The Bible teaches that all have sinned and come short of the glory of God, and that there is none righteous, no not one (Romans 3:23 & 3:10). Of course, this has become a very unpopular doctrine. Regardless of the popularity of the doctrine, we are so sinful that if we die in our sins, we will go to Hell.
Everyone needs to hear the gospel of Jesus Christ. The gospel message is that we have all sinned, but Jesus Christ suffered and died on the cross as an offering for our sins. Christ loved us so much that he was willing to be crucified on our behalf. Not only did he die on the cross, but after three days, he rose from the dead! However, there is more to the new birth than just hearing the gospel message. The Bible teaches that the Holy Spirit accomponies the message and convicts the heart of the unbeliever. This is a doctrine that is almost totally ignored in today's society. Jesus himself said that he would send the Comforter (Holy Spirit) to convict the world of sin (John 16:8). Throughout the book of Acts, lost people were pricked to the heart after hearing the gospel message. We live in an age that emphasizes going through a ritual or procedure in order to be saved, and ignores the work of the Holy Spirit in the heart of a lost man. Never assume you are born again just because you joined a church, were baptized, repeated a prayer, signed a card, etc.
The Bible tells us that when someone is convicted of his sin, he must believe in Christ and repent of his sins. Jesus himself said, repent ye, and believe the gospel. Repentance means to ask God to forgive you of your sins and your sinful nature. The Bible urges the lost to call upon the name of the Lord and to repent of sins. When a lost person truly repents of his sins, his heart is broken and contrite. Faith in Christ is not just a shallow mental acceptance of who Jesus is. It is from the heart that man believes in Christ unto salvation.
How do you know that you have trusted in Christ unto salvation? How can you know that you have had the faith necessary? The Bible tells us that the Holy Spirit himself dwells in the hearts of true believers, and that we have a peace with God that passes all understanding. I know that I was saved by the grace of God as a ten year old boy, because I could feel the presence of God in my heart. What I advise anyone to do is to call upon the Lord for salvation from your sins until God lets you know that you are born again. Some people are saved very quickly, and others take more time. The key is to seek the Lord until he lets you know that you are born again. I remember when my son was born, and I remember where my son was born. There was a time and a place when he was born into this world. One moment, he was unborn, and the next he was born. The new birth is very similar. You are either saved or lost. When a person is born again, it happens at a particular time and place. Even though people can be confused about when and where they are saved, someone who is saved should remember the moment when he surrendered everything to Christ and felt the peace of God enter his heart.
